Drain Field Replacement in San Antonio, TX

Drain field replacement services involve removing and installing new drain fields to ensure proper wastewater dispersal from a property’s septic system. This process is typically needed when the existing drain field has failed, become clogged, or is no longer functioning efficiently. Projects can range from replacing a small section of the drain field to complete system overhauls, especially on properties where the current setup no longer meets the household’s needs or local regulations. Homeowners usually want to understand the signs of drain field failure, such as persistent odors, standing water, or lush patches of grass, and seek guidance on what to expect during the replacement process.

Before requesting drain field replacement, property owners should consider factors like the age of the existing system, soil conditions, and the extent of damage or deterioration. It’s important to evaluate whether repairs might be sufficient or if a full replacement is necessary. Additionally, understanding the scope of work involved, potential disruptions to the property, and any permits or inspections required can help homeowners plan accordingly. Proper assessment ensures that the new drain field will function effectively and meet the property’s wastewater management needs.

FAQ

Drain Field Replacement Questions

What is drain field replacement? It involves removing and installing a new drain field to ensure proper wastewater dispersal from a septic system.

When is drain field replacement needed? Replacement is typically necessary if the drain field is failing, saturated, or causing backups and odors.

What signs indicate a drain field may need replacement? Common signs include standing water, foul smells, slow drains, or lush, unusually green patches in the yard.

How does drain field replacement benefit property owners? It restores proper wastewater flow and helps prevent costly backups and property damage.
